> The BUILD_LOG_REGEX token has a substText parameter, you specify the
> replacement you want to replace the matched regex with. You can use the
> same syntax for the replacement string as is supported by appendReplacement
> of the Matcher object, e.g., (this does not solve your issue, you'll have
> to determine the regex and replacement for you).
>
> ${BUILD_LOG_REGEX,regex="Something(.*)",substText="$1"}
